The 2024 Writing in Color Fest was held on September 27-29 in person—with some virtual offerings—at Lighthouse Writers Workshop in Denver, Colorado.

Join us for Writing in Color Fest—an annual event designed to celebrate and amplify the voices of BIPOC+ writers. This year's theme is Say It Loud! Whether working on a novel, memoir, short fiction, poetry, or hybrid forms, our experienced faculty and guest instructors will work closely with you to support your writing process before we gather in the evening for free community events. Writing in Color Fest is open to writers of all genres and creatives who identify as Black, Indigenous, or People of Color (BIPOC+). The goal of the Fest is to provide a space for writers of color to be in community and thrive as they grow their writing skills.

Intensives
The 2024 festival featured virtual and in person, three and two-day intensives focused on poetry, fiction, nonfiction, and hybrid forms. These intensives were taught by Wendy Chen, Natalie Hodges, and André Hoilette.

Craft Seminars
Craft seminars are one-time workshops that focus on developing and learning about a specific skill or particular element of a genre or writing technique. The festival's 2024 craft seminars were taught by Olivia Abtahi, Jasmine Griffin, Katerina Jeng, Vanessa Mártir, Suzi Q. Smith, Marisa Tirado, and Erika T. Wurth.

Lunchtime Panels
Lunchtime panels at the Writing in Color Fest feature local authors, Lighthouse instructors, and experts will guide you through essential steps in your writing journey. At the 2024 festival, participants explore opportunities such as residencies, fellowships, mentorship programs, and literary awards with Juan Morales, Anna Qu, and Erika T. Wurth and gained insights into navigating the publishing world from Kanika Agrawal, Aerik Francis, and literary agent Renée Jarvis.

Evening Events
The 2024 Writing in Color Fest included a variety of evening events focused on building community and finding creative inspiration. This year's lineup included a Writing in Color fellows reading and open mic, community dinner, trivia and board game night hosted by Black People Know Things, and more!
